ABOUT TELECOMPETITOR
Telecompetitor is a news website for the rural broadband industry, focusing on news that’s relevant to Tier 3 and Tier 2 providers. Telecompetitor is known as an industry leader, providing insight, analysis, and commentary on the evolving broadband landscape.
